Welcome to the charming Appleby train station, nestled in Cumbria's Eden District. It serves as a quaint gateway to both the scenic landscapes of the Lake District and Yorkshire Dales, making it an ideal stop for travelers seeking a blend of natural beauty and convenient rail travel. Whether you're venturing out for a refreshing countryside escape or simply commuting, Appleby offers a few critical amenities and services to kickstart your journey.
Appleby station features a straightforward layout with two platforms linked by a footbridge. The station's ticket office is operational from Monday to Saturday and is conveniently equipped with ticket machines for collecting online purchases. However, while smartcards are issued here, you'll need to validate them elsewhere as the station lacks validators.
Staff assistance is available during the same hours as the ticket office, and travelers are encouraged to use the helpline if visiting outside of these times. Accessibility-wise, there are partial step-free access routes, although some areas may be steep. The station does accommodate with induction loops and ramps for train access, but accessible toilets are not available on-site.
For those looking to utilize parking facilities, the station car park has 25 spaces, including two accessible ones, with very affordable daily charges. However, facilities such as CCTV, accessible toilets, refreshment options, and shops are unfortunately absent.
Getting around from Appleby station is straightforward, with various travel links ensuring a seamless transition from train to other transportation modes. Rail replacement services make use of the station car park for convenient passenger pick-up and drop-off. If taxis are more your speed, there’s straightforward access via Northern Railway's cab service. Local bus services add another dimension to the travel flexibility, with information available for journey planning. Although cycling enthusiasts might need an alternative, as cycle hire and parking aren't provided here.
From Appleby, you can set off on a variety of enticing journeys. A direct line to Carlisle opens up a host of further connections while heading toward Settle or Ribblehead reveals the stunning views along the Settle-Carlisle railway line. For those seeking a longer adventure, connections to urban landscapes can take you all the way to Edinburgh or London King’s Cross.

As you plan your journey through the Midlands, Derby Train Station stands out as a crucial hub, linking travelers with major destinations across the UK. Whether you're a commuter, a leisurely traveler, or on a business trip, Derby Train Station offers a seamless experience with modern amenities and efficient services. Situated in Derbyshire, this station serves as an integral part of the local and national rail network, and is managed by East Midlands Railway.
Derby Train Station is well-equipped to handle a variety of passenger needs. The ticket office operates with extensive hours, from early morning at 04:55 until late at night at 22:45 during the week, with slightly adjusted hours on the weekend. For those who prefer digital solutions, ticket machines are available and include facilities for collecting online purchases. Accessibility is a focus here, with step-free access across the entire station, supported by lifts and tactile paving.
This station has a notable commitment to customer assistance and safety. Staff are readily available to help, and several help points are dotted around for immediate inquiries. While there are no luggage storage facilities, the lost property office at Nottingham offers a robust service for misplaced items. Safety is enhanced with CCTV covering both the station and car park areas.
For seamless transitions to other modes of transportation, Derby Train Station offers several options. A taxi rank can be found on the station forecourt for quick, convenient transfers. The KinchBus's "Skylink" service operates a 24-hour schedule connecting passengers directly to East Midlands Airport, ensuring easy access to international travel.
Bus services are also comprehensively covered, with information readily available and even in a printable format for the organized traveler. For those moments when regular service is disrupted, rail replacement services can be accessed from the Pride Park exit, ensuring continuity of travel.
Derby is strategically positioned, allowing considerable flexibility in travel with direct routes to major cities. You can quickly journey to London St Pancras International for a day in the capital or head to Sheffield for some northern charm. If you're looking to explore the dynamics of Leicester, the trains are fast and frequent, as are the services to Birmingham New Street and Nottingham.
For daily commuters and travelers with bicycles, Derby Station provides 204 sheltered bike spaces equipped with CCTV for peace of mind. The car park runs 24 hours with a range of tickets catering to short and long stays, making it convenient for all types of travelers. Refreshment facilities at the station ensure you are fueled and ready for your journey, and while there's no public Wi-Fi, the spacious waiting areas come with comfortable seating and heating.
